RayzeBio is a dynamic biotechnology company headquartered in San Diego, California, United States. Launched in late 2020 and recently acquired by Bristol Myers Squibb (BMS) as a wholly owned subsidiary, the company is focused on improving survival for people with cancer by harnessing the power of targeted radioisotopes. RayzeBio will operate as a standalone entity within the BMS organization, maintaining its biotech culture with the opportunity to leverage the best-in-class oncology capabilities of BMS. RayzeBio is developing innovative drugs against targets of solid tumors. The lead asset, RYZ101, is in Phase 3 testing for patients with gastroenteropancreatic neuroendocrine tumors (GEP-NETs), as well as earlier stage testing for patients with small cell lung cancer (SCLC). Summary
RayzeBio is looking for a Senior Associate Scientist I/II, to support in the development of novel therapeutics in preclinical stages. Candidates will work as part of a team of scientists to synthesize and design both small molecules and peptide analogs to optimize potency, pharmacokinetics, and in vivo efficacy of potential drug candidates.
